Note 18: Restricted Stock Units

 

During the three months ended March 31, 2022, the Company granted 300,000 RSUs to a nonemployee with a fair market value of $268,500. The RSUs were granted on March 17, 2022, with a three-year vesting period and a five-year term.

 

During the three months ended June 30, 2022, the Company granted 469,677 fully vested RSUs to a nonemployee for production services with a fair market value of $286,806. The RSUs were granted on May 10, 2022 with a five-year term and recorded as part of capitalized production costs.

 

During the three months ended June 30, 2022, the Company also granted 500,000 RSUs to a former employee of Wow, as a new employee of the Company after the acquisition date, with a fair market value of $390,000. The RSUs were granted on June 23, 2022, with a three-year vesting period and a five-year term.

During the three months ended June 30, 2022 and 2021, the Company recognized $3.8 million and $0.8 million, respectively, in share-based compensation expense related to RSUs. During the six months ended June 30, 2022 and 2021, the Company recognized $7.9 million and $1.9 million, respectively, in share-based compensation expense related to RSUs. The unrecognized share-based compensation expense related to RSUs at June 30, 2022 of $2.9 million, will be recognized through the second quarter of 2025 based on the remaining vesting periods, assuming the underlying grants are not cancelled or forfeited.
